Jerry's Salad Dressing

Plain non fat yogurt any brand
2 Tablespoon of Mayo, ( Jerry prefers Dukes because it is sugar free)
Papkrika, onion powder, dillweed, garlic powder. (any seasonings)
You could add chilli seasonings or pepper flakes to spice it up.

This beats all the added not good for you things. Trust me there is nothing to fattening in this dressing. The kids love it on their salad.

Pizza ( It's a mushroom not real pizza)

One of things that I have made is portabella mushroom with a small amount of cheese and Parmesan cheese melted. I broil this in the oven.With Tomato sauce. Patience really likes this. I could put some grilled onions on it also or sauteed bell pepper or grilled tomato  with basil or italian herbs on the top.

Like I said we have found different ways of cooking veggies. This is a nice meal when you really would love to have pizza but do not need the calories or carbs. She likes her to be alittle crispy on the top.

 This is Patience Breakfast
Whole wheat Waffle
Turkey sausage
Strawberries
Almond butter for the syrup

Sometimes we put a small amount of sugar free spreadable fruit
She does not eat a waffle everyday, this morning we will be in church

Light breakfast.
In the mornings for breakfast I usually have a whey protein shake, a Banana, and a Tablespoon of Almond butter. Freezing the banana makes the shake thicker. Then a couple hours later I will have a apple or boiled egg. If i were really hungry when drinking the shake I could always add a little of dry uncooked oatmeal.
Remembering to drink tons of water.
